Gatwick runway opponents march through Horsham

More than 120 people marched through Horsham town centre on Saturday, May 3, to protest against a new runway at Gatwick Airport and new flight paths. They set off from the carfax to the Drill Hall, where Gatwick was holding one of its 16 public exhibitions, showing the public the runways plans, some of which they will be submitting to the Airports Commission by 16th May. Communities Against Gatwick Noise Emissions (CAGNE), with the help of Gatwick Area Conservation Campaign (GACC) and Campaign to Protect Rural England (CPRE) Sussex, organised the walk through Horsham town centre and their attendance outside the exhibition. CAGNE and GACC have between them had a presence at all of the exhibitions, and given out information to those attending on why they believe firmly that there should not be a new runway – due to the social and environmental damage it would do the area, for miles around the airport in all directions.

Chair of CAGNE, Sally Pavey said: “A real mix of ages walked and gathered on the steps of Drill Hall before going in to ask questions about new flight paths, lack of infrastructure, mass house building to accommodate inward migrating workers to fill jobs, removal of woodlands and floodplains being built on, road congestion and the emissions from the road and sky.”

The deadline for the public consultation is Friday, May 16. Response can be made at www.gatwickairport.com/consultation.
